When a Buddhist monk watches a Bollywood crime drama, what does he see?

In this profound and accessible work, an ordained Theravada Buddhist monk analyzes Vishal Bhardwaj's masterpiece
Omkara (2006)-a searing adaptation of Shakespeare's Othello set in the violent world of rural Uttar Pradesh
politics-and reveals how 2,500-year-old Buddhist wisdom illuminates this contemporary tragedy with startling
